A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 | 
| 
 
			 | 
AN ACT
 | 
|   | 
| 
 
			 | 
relating to the personal needs allowance for certain Medicaid  | 
| 
 
			 | 
recipients who are residents of long-term care facilities. | 
| 
 
			 | 
       B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: | 
| 
 
			 | 
       SECTION 1.  Subsection (w), Section 32.024, Human Resources  | 
| 
 
			 | 
Code, is amended to read as follows: | 
| 
 
			 | 
       (w)  The department shall set a personal needs allowance of  | 
| 
 
			 | 
not less than $60 [$45] a month for a resident of a convalescent or  | 
| 
 
			 | 
nursing home or related institution licensed under Chapter 242,  | 
| 
 
			 | 
Health and Safety Code, personal care facility, ICF-MR facility, or  | 
| 
 
			 | 
other similar long-term care facility who receives medical  | 
| 
 
			 | 
assistance.  The department may send the personal needs allowance  | 
| 
 
			 | 
directly to a resident who receives Supplemental Security Income  | 
| 
 
			 | 
(SSI) (42 U.S.C. Section 1381 et seq.).  This subsection does not  | 
| 
 
			 | 
apply to a resident who is participating in a medical assistance  | 
| 
 
			 | 
waiver program administered by the department. | 
| 
 
			 | 
       SECTION 2.  If before implementing any provision of this Act  | 
| 
 
			 | 
a state agency determines that a waiver or authorization from a  | 
| 
 
			 | 
federal agency is necessary for implementation of that provision,  | 
| 
 
			 | 
the agency affected by the provision shall request the waiver or  | 
| 
 
			 | 
authorization and may delay implementing that provision until the  | 
| 
 
			 | 
waiver or authorization is granted. | 
| 
 
			 | 
       SECTION 3.  Subsection (w), Section 32.024, Human Resources  | 
| 
 
			 | 
Code, as amended by this Act, applies only to a personal needs  | 
| 
 
			 | 
allowance paid on or after the effective date of this Act. | 
| 
 
			 | 
       SECTION 4.  This Act takes effect September 1, 2007. |
